Well another main reason Blizz implemented it in the first place was so rogues could actually catch up to enemies that are moving away from them. It was only useable while under stealth so I think that achieves what you are asking, doesn’t it? It also required 30 energy to use too, which was replenished quickly enough to where BoS could be maintained but you had to still time your attacks properly or else you would open up with very little energy.

Well to be fair, BoS was pretty OP in its previous form. Potential 100% uptime coupled with snare removal (iirc) is impossible to balance. I feel that if they reintroduced it with an 8-10 second CD, 30-40 energy cost, and it can’t remove snares that might be a bit easier to deal with. Maybe give it a condition that if you’re snared BoS allows you to not be reduced below 100% movement speed.

Yeah, I can see why it could be cause for concern but it could have been changed to not break snares and not exceed a set threshold, regardless of speed enhancing abilities rather than just be outright removed.
